The new Dissociative Subtype of PTSD Interview (DSP-I) effectively assesses post-traumatic stress disorder with dissociative subtype (PTSD-DS). This validated tool aids clinicians in identifying and differentiating crucial dissociative symptoms in trauma survivors.
